Best for: Busy parents who need a lightweight, compact stroller for travel and everyday errands. This model weighs only 13 lb, easing lifting and storage.

Why selected: It combines ultra-lightweight travel design with a compact self-stand fold (18 x 12 x 34 inches) and a large, extended 3-tier canopy. The canopy offers UV protection and a peek-a-boo window for quick checks on a napping toddler.

Limitations: As an umbrella stroller, it may have a smaller seat area compared with full-size strollers, which can feel snug for larger toddlers during long walks.

Best for: Parents who travel frequently and need a lightweight option with a full-sized seat and multi-position recline. It weighs about 11 pounds and includes auto-lock and lockable rear wheels.

Why selected: The 3D Mini Convenience Stroller balances lightness with seating comfort, offering multi-position recline suitable for naps and longer strolls. It’s a strong pick for growing toddlers who still require a compact fold for travel.

Caution: The maximum supported weight is stated as 45 pounds, which is a common cap for this class; verify your child’s weight and height before extended use.

Buying Guide

What matters most for big-toddler strollers?

Weight capacity, seat comfort, and the ability to fold compactly are key. Look for strollers that support at least 40 pounds and offer multi-position reclining for nap-time comfort. For travel, a one-handed fold and a self-standing position simplify transitions in airports or car trunks.

Which features are essential for travel?

Lightweight design, easy-to-use harness, compact fold, and a canopy with UV protection are essential. If you plan to visit theme parks or long days out, pick a model with a larger storage basket and easy maneuverability.

Consider comfort and durability

Rigid frame vs. flexible suspension affects ride quality. Look for padded seats and a stable five-point harness. Aluminum frames reduce weight while maintaining strength, helpful for big toddlers who outgrow lighter options quickly.

Safety and compatibility

Check that the stroller meets basic safety standards and has secure wheels, reliable brakes, and a secure fold mechanism. If you need to pair a stroller with infant seating, verify compatibility with car seats or car-seat adapters listed by the brand.

Maintenance and longevity

Inspect fabric wear, zippers, and the canopy’s integrity. A stroller designed for frequent folding and unfolding should use reinforced joints and durable fabrics that resist tearing and fading with sun exposure.
